Router R2 is receiving hello packets from a neighbor with the IP address 192.168.10.10 via the R2 S0/0/1 interface.Question 10: Which prompt is used to allow a user to change the IP address of an interface on a router?

Answer:

Router(config-if)# Question 11: Which default EIGRP configuration must be modified to allow an EIGRP router to advertise subnets that are configured with VLSM

Answer:

autosummarization

Question 12: Refer to the exhibit. The 10.4.0.0 network fails. What mechanism prevents R2 from receiving false update information regarding the 10.4.0.0 network?

Answer:

split horizon Question 13: Which routing protocol maintains a topology table separate from the routing table?

Answer:

EIGRP Question 14: Refer to the exhibit. A network administrator has configured OSPF using the following command: network 192.168.1.32 0.0.0.31 area 0 Which router interface will participate in OSPF?

Answer:

Serial0/0/0 Question 15: Refer to the exhibit. The network administrator has run the following command on R1. R1(config)# ip route 192.168.2.0 255.255.255.0 172.16.1.2 What is the result of running this command?

Answer:

Traffic for network 192.168.2.0 is forwarded to 172.16.1.2.Question 16: Refer to the exhibit. RouterA and RouterB cannot successfully exchange EIGRP routes. What is the problem?

Answer:

The autonomous system numbers do not match.Question 17: A network administrator is setting up a new router with a device name of Admin, an encrypted password of cangetin, and the IP address 192.168.1.22/29 assigned to the first FastEthernet interface. Which command sequence correctly configures this router?

Answer:

Router(config)# hostname Admin Admin(config)# enable secret cangetin Admin(config)# interface fa0/0 Admin(config-if)# ip address 192.168.1.22 255.255.255.248

Question 18: Which statement correctly describes a feature of RIP

Answer:

RIP uses only one metric-hop count- for path selection.

Question 19: Which of the following are required when adding a network to the OSPF routing process configuration? (Choose three.)

Answer:

network address wildcard mask area ID Question 20: Refer to the exhibit. A technician has configured the interfaces on the Router, but upon inspection discovers that interface FastEthernet0/1 is not functioning. Which action will most likely correct the problem with FastEthernet0/1?

Answer:

The no shutdown command needs to be added to the interface configuration.Question 21: Which two statements are true about the router ID in a single area OSPF network?(Choose two.)

Answer:

The router ID is used to uniquely identify each router in the OSPF routing domain. If no loopback interfaces are configured, the router chooses the highest active IP address of any of its physical interfaces Question 22: Which two statements about routing protocols are accurate? (Choose two.)

Answer:

OSPF supports VLSM. EIGRP supports discontiguous network designs Question 23: Refer to the exhibit. Which summarization should R1 use to advertise its networks to R2

Answer:

192.168.0.0/22

Question 24: You have been asked to explain converged networks to a trainee. How would you accurately describe a converged network?

Answer:

A network is converged after all routers share the same information, calculate best paths, and update their routing tables.Question 25: All routers in a network are configured in a single OSPF area with the same priority value. No loopback interface has been set on any of the routers. Which secondary value will the routers use to determine the router ID?

Answer:

The highest IP address among the active FastEthernet interfaces that are running OSPF will be used.
